Learn More About Creating Realistic CT Scan Machine Pictures with AI
To generate realistic CT scan machine pictures, start with descriptive prompts that include terms like 'CT scan machine,' 'medical imaging,' 'radiology equipment,' and specify the desired style such as 'photorealistic,' 'clinical,' or 'detailed.' You can also experiment with different AI models available on NightCafe, as some are better suited for generating highly realistic and detailed imagery.
For medical imaging visuals, focus on precise language. Include keywords related to the specific equipment (e.g., 'CT scanner,' 'MRI machine,' 'X-ray'), the environment ('hospital room,' 'radiology department,' 'control room'), and the desired aesthetic ('clean,' 'sterile,' 'high-tech,' 'anatomical detail'). Adding details about lighting and camera angles can also enhance realism.

While our AI strives for realism and can produce visually striking and detailed images, they are generated based on patterns and data learned from existing images. They should not be considered medically accurate representations for diagnostic or clinical purposes. These images are best suited for artistic, educational, or conceptual applications.
